India's Automotive Pivot: Balancing Efficiency Mandates with Energy Sovereignty
India's draft CAFE III norms aim to slash fleet emissions by 2032 while navigating the shift from traditional engines to electrification. The proposal introduces flexibility mechanisms that critics argue might prioritize compliance over actual technological transformation.

The Evolution of Efficiency Standards
The Ministry of Power's July 16 draft notification for Corporate Average Fuel Efficiency (CAFE) III marks a decisive moment for India’s automotive sector. Originally conceived in the United States in 1975 to mitigate oil dependence following the Arab oil embargo, CAFE standards have evolved from simple fuel-saving measures into a primary tool for curbing greenhouse gas emissions. India now faces a similar crossroad: utilizing these mandates to secure energy independence from expensive crude imports while transitioning toward electrified mobility.
Global Blueprints and the Indian Framework
China’s trajectory offers a stark comparison for Indian regulators. Since 2004, Beijing has transitioned from weight-based vehicle regulation to a Dual Credit System established in 2018. This mechanism forces manufacturers to balance fuel-consumption targets with specific New Energy Vehicle (NEV) credits. The market impact is significant; the International Energy Agency’s Global EV Outlook 2024 notes that electric cars accounted for 55% of Chinese sales in 2025, compared to approximately 4% in India, 10% in the U.S., and 27% in the European Union.
The Indian proposal aims to reduce average fleet emissions from 113 gCO2/km to 77 gCO2/km by the 2031-32 fiscal year. Early industry lobbying led to a proposal that exempted lighter small cars, but the current draft has removed that carve-out, forcing a uniform push toward cleaner technology across the board. Key industry players face diverging paths: while Mahindra and Tata Motors generate credits through electric portfolios, Maruti Suzuki could face an 18% credit deficit without EV intervention, potentially forcing them to purchase credits from competitors.
The Risks of Flexibility Mechanisms
The effectiveness of the CAFE III targets remains tied to several administrative levers that may dilute their impact:
- Carbon Neutrality Factors: Credits are awarded for vehicles compatible with high ethanol blends. However, the government has reached no firm decision on moving beyond E20 blending, and ethanol’s lower energy density results in reduced mileage.
- Super Credits: Battery EVs, plug-in hybrids, and flex-fuel vehicles receive extra weight in fleet calculations. This allows a small number of cleaner sales to mask continued production of high-emission models.
- Credit Trading: Manufacturers can buy credits from the Bureau of Energy Efficiency (BEE) at fixed prices—₹2,500 per gram of CO2/km in 2028, rising to ₹4,500 by 2032. Some analysts argue this provides a loophole for laggards to avoid upgrading legacy technology.
While these mechanisms provide a safety net for manufacturers, they risk turning the BEE into a seller of last resort rather than a catalyst for innovation. The Energy Conservation Act maintains sharper teeth, with penalties of up to ₹50,000 per vehicle for significant non-compliance, yet the low cost of administrative credits might allow some firms to delay deep electrification in favor of immediate financial compliance.
